-- AME Real Estate Investment Trust (KLSE:AMEREIT) recorded a revaluation surplus of about 86 million ringgit on its investment property portfolio for the financial year ended March 31, according to a Wednesday Malaysian bourse filing.
Shares gained 3% in Thursday's afternoon trade.
The uplift in property values is expected to increase the company's net asset value per unit to about 1.26 ringgit before income distribution.
The exercise was conducted for accounting purposes under Malaysian financial reporting standards and REIT guidelines requiring annual revaluations, the filing said.
